Inspiration

Dealing with the hassle of tailoring resumes and crafting cover letters across online tools can be overwhelming. Recognising job applicants' challenges, the idea of creating a comprehensive solution emerged. Inspired by the difficulties in the job application process, we envisioned a tool that streamlines every step. Our solution allows applicants to customise resumes for specific job descriptions, generate tailored cover letters, and receive answers to common questions—all in one place. Additionally, we've integrated a user-friendly ChatBot for seamless interaction. This tool is born from the desire to simplify and enhance the job application experience.

What it does

JobApplyPal is a comprehensive solution designed to streamline and enhance the job application process. Here's a breakdown of what JobApplyPal does: Resume Tailoring: JobApplyPal analyses your resume in real time, aligning it with specific job descriptions. Provides instant feedback and suggestions to enhance your resume's effectiveness. It aims to transform your resume into a compelling document that stands out to recruiters. Cover Letter Generation: Our tools generate personalised cover letters tailored to your resume and the job requirements. Ensures your cover letter is unique, impactful, and aligned with the specific position you're applying for. FAQ Answers: JobApplyPal answers frequently asked questions related to job applications. Tailor's responses are based on your resume and the job description, providing clear and concise information. ChatBot Interaction: Our tool features an intelligent ChatBot that is available 24/7. Offers instant responses to queries, providing additional support and clarification throughout the application process. Enhances user experience by providing on-demand assistance tailored to individual needs.

How we built it

Our application's development involved using PartyRock, an interactive and shareable generative AI app-building tool. We took a hands-on approach to creating specific functionalities by designing individual widgets within the PartyRock framework. These widgets were essential components, each serving a distinct purpose in our application.

Our decision to use PartyRock was fueled by its fun and intuitive nature, making it an ideal choice for our project. As a generative AI app-building tool, PartyRock offered pre-trained models that could be harnessed for various tasks. We seamlessly integrated these models into our widgets to leverage their generative capabilities.

We had to provide task-specific prompts to each widget to tailor the application to our needs. This step was crucial for instructing the generative models on effectively interpreting and responding to the user input. Users are prompted to input their Resume and Job Description into the designated widgets, triggering the tool to generate accurate and customised answers based on the provided prompts.

Our approach involved a creative and strategic use of PartyRock's capabilities. We learned to navigate the tool, understand its features, and effectively utilise pre-trained generative models to build a user-friendly and efficient application that meets the unique demands of job applicants.

Challenges we ran into

When we initially embarked on this project using PartyRock, our team faced a significant learning curve as we navigated the features and capabilities of the tool. As newcomers, grasping the intricacies of PartyRock proved challenging, and we needed some time to understand its functionalities and how to utilize them for our application effectively.

Once we became more familiar with the tool, a specific challenge emerged during the development phase. Crafting the proper prompts for each widget became crucial to ensure that the generated answers were accurate and tailored to our intended functionalities. Crafting the prompts required a careful balance of specificity and clarity in our prompts, which we fine-tuned over time to optimise the performance of each widget.

In summary, our primary challenges revolved around the initial learning curve associated with PartyRock and the subsequent task of refining prompts to ensure precise and contextually relevant answers from the widgets. These challenges were instrumental in shaping our understanding of the tool and ultimately enhancing the overall effectiveness of our application.

Accomplishments that we're proud of

We take pride in developing a tool that serves as a comprehensive solution, simplifying the job application process for applicants. Creating a one-stop platform that seamlessly addresses the needs of job seekers has been a significant accomplishment for our team. This achievement reflects our commitment to enhancing user experience and streamlining the often challenging job application journey.

What we learned

Throughout the development of our application, we gained valuable insights and knowledge. Firstly, as a team, we learned to adapt and familiarise ourselves with a new tool, PartyRock. Navigating its features and understanding its capabilities presented a learning curve, but it also highlighted our ability to grasp and incorporate new technologies into our workflow quickly.

Additionally, we honed our skills in crafting effective prompts for each widget, a crucial aspect of ensuring accurate and tailored responses. This experience deepened our understanding of optimising the performance of generative models within PartyRock, providing us with valuable expertise in utilising such tools for future projects.

Furthermore, the project underscored the importance of user-centric design. We learned the significance of creating a tool that addresses specific functionalities and prioritises user experience. This emphasis on usability and clarity in our application design will undoubtedly influence our approach to future projects, reinforcing the importance of user satisfaction and accessibility.

Our journey taught us adaptability, technical proficiency with PartyRock, the nuances of crafting effective prompts, and the paramount importance of user-centric design in creating successful applications. These lessons form a solid foundation for our ongoing growth as a development team.

What's next for JobApplyPal

We strive to improve the JobApplyPal tool by creating a dedicated website highlighting its current capabilities. In addition to the existing features, we plan to provide users with a refined resume after generating their ATS score. Our goals involve introducing a tracking feature for monitoring submitted applications and integrating a reminder system for interviews and screening tests to assist candidates throughout the job application process.

Built With

  • partyrock
Share this project:

Updates